Aloe Vera Gel Market Long-Term Outlook: Growth Prospects, Emerging Trends, and Industry Transformation
The aloe vera gel market is positioned for sustained long-term development as consumers, manufacturers, and formulators increasingly favor plant-based ingredients with versatile functional properties. Aloe vera gel is widely used across personal care, cosmetics, pharmaceuticals, food and beverages, and wellness products. Its association with skin hydration, soothing properties, digestive wellness, and natural formulations has helped establish it as a commercially valuable botanical ingredient.
Over the long term, market development is expected to be shaped by changing consumer preferences, product innovation, expanding applications, improved cultivation practices, and growing interest in clean-label formulations. Manufacturers are also focusing on improving extraction, stabilization, purification, packaging, and processing technologies to preserve the quality and functional characteristics of aloe vera gel.
The Aloe Vera Gel Market Long-Term Outlook therefore points toward a market that is likely to become more diversified, technology-driven, and quality-focused rather than relying solely on conventional cosmetic applications.
Rising Preference for Plant-Based Ingredients
One of the most important long-term influences on the market is the growing preference for naturally derived ingredients. Consumers are paying closer attention to ingredient lists and increasingly seeking products positioned around botanical, organic, clean-label, and environmentally responsible formulations.
Aloe vera fits well within this transition because it can be incorporated into a broad range of products. Skincare creams, facial gels, after-sun products, moisturizers, shampoos, conditioners, lotions, and personal hygiene products commonly use aloe vera as a functional botanical ingredient.
This preference is expected to remain important over the coming years as manufacturers reformulate products to appeal to consumers who want recognizable and plant-derived ingredients.
Expansion Across Personal Care and Cosmetics
Personal care is likely to remain a major application area for aloe vera gel. The ingredient's moisturizing and soothing characteristics make it attractive for products designed for sensitive, dry, irritated, or sun-exposed skin.
Future product development is expected to move beyond traditional aloe vera gels. Manufacturers may increasingly incorporate aloe vera into facial serums, masks, body lotions, scalp treatments, after-sun formulations, shaving products, and specialized skin-care products.
Premium beauty brands may also emphasize high-purity aloe vera, sustainably sourced ingredients, and transparent processing. This creates opportunities for suppliers capable of delivering consistent quality and traceability.
Opportunities in Functional Food and Beverage Products
Another important long-term avenue is the food and beverage sector. Aloe vera-based drinks and wellness products have gained attention among consumers interested in functional and plant-based beverages.
Future opportunities may include aloe vera beverages, flavored wellness drinks, nutritional formulations, and products combining aloe vera with other botanical ingredients. However, food applications require careful attention to taste, safety, processing stability, and regulatory requirements.
Companies that successfully address these challenges can create differentiated products rather than competing solely on raw aloe vera content.
Technological Improvements in Processing
Technology will play an increasingly important role in determining the future competitiveness of aloe vera gel suppliers. Aloe vera gel is sensitive to processing and storage conditions, making stabilization and preservation critical for maintaining product quality.
Advances in extraction, filtration, concentration, drying, stabilization, and packaging can help manufacturers improve shelf life while retaining desirable characteristics. Processing technologies that reduce degradation and contamination risks may become increasingly valuable.
There is also potential for greater use of standardized processing systems that deliver consistent batches. This is particularly important for pharmaceutical, nutraceutical, and premium personal care applications, where manufacturers require predictable ingredient specifications.
Growing Importance of Product Purity and Standardization
As aloe vera becomes more widely incorporated into sophisticated formulations, buyers are likely to place greater emphasis on purity, consistency, and documentation.
Variations in cultivation conditions, harvesting practices, processing methods, and storage can influence the characteristics of aloe vera gel. Consequently, suppliers with strong quality-control systems may gain an advantage.
Long-term competitiveness is likely to depend on capabilities such as batch testing, traceability, standardized active components, contaminant control, and reliable supply documentation. These factors can help manufacturers build stronger relationships with global customers.
Sustainable Aloe Vera Cultivation
Environmental considerations are expected to become increasingly important across the aloe vera supply chain. Agriculture faces growing pressure to use water, land, fertilizers, and other resources efficiently.
Aloe vera's suitability for relatively dry environments can support its appeal as a botanical crop, but responsible cultivation remains essential. Producers may increasingly adopt water-efficient irrigation, soil-management practices, responsible harvesting, renewable energy solutions, and improved agricultural monitoring.
Sustainable sourcing could also become an important selling point for personal care and beauty companies seeking to reduce the environmental impact of their ingredient portfolios.
Geographic Diversification of Supply
The long-term market is also likely to experience greater diversification in cultivation and processing. Aloe vera is cultivated in multiple regions with suitable climatic conditions, providing opportunities for producers to develop regional supply networks.
Greater geographic diversification can reduce dependence on individual production areas and potentially strengthen supply-chain resilience. At the same time, inconsistent weather, agricultural disruptions, transportation costs, and changes in input prices can continue to affect raw material availability.
Companies may respond by developing stronger relationships with growers, investing in local processing infrastructure, and maintaining more flexible sourcing strategies.
Increasing Demand for Specialized Formulations
The future of the market will not be limited to conventional aloe vera products. Specialized formulations represent an important opportunity for value creation.
Manufacturers can develop aloe vera products targeted toward specific consumer requirements, including sensitive-skin care, hydration, scalp wellness, after-sun care, and premium botanical beauty. Combining aloe vera with ingredients such as botanical extracts, vitamins, minerals, hyaluronic acid, or other functional components can create differentiated formulations.
Customization can also enable companies to serve different demographic groups and price segments. This shift from commodity-oriented products toward application-specific formulations could support higher-value opportunities.
Role of Clean-Label and Transparent Marketing
Consumers increasingly want to understand where ingredients come from and how products are manufactured. This trend is likely to influence aloe vera brands and ingredient suppliers over the long term.
Companies may increasingly communicate information regarding cultivation, processing, ingredient sourcing, formulation standards, and sustainability practices. Transparent labeling can strengthen consumer confidence, particularly in premium skincare and wellness categories.
However, companies will need to ensure that marketing claims remain accurate and appropriately supported. Responsible communication will become increasingly important as consumers become more knowledgeable about botanical ingredients.
Challenges Affecting Long-Term Development
Despite favorable prospects, the market faces several challenges. Raw material quality can vary according to climate, cultivation methods, harvesting practices, and processing conditions. Maintaining consistent quality at scale can therefore be difficult.
Another challenge involves preservation and stabilization. Aloe vera gel can deteriorate if not processed and stored correctly, creating pressure for manufacturers to invest in effective technologies.
Competition may also increase as more botanical ingredients enter personal care and wellness formulations. Aloe vera suppliers will need to demonstrate clear functional, quality, sustainability, or cost advantages.
Regulatory requirements can further influence market development, particularly for food, pharmaceutical, and health-oriented applications. Companies expanding internationally may need to navigate different standards and labeling requirements across markets.
Competitive Strategies for the Future
Long-term success is likely to favor companies that combine reliable sourcing with technological capabilities and product innovation. Vertical integration could become more attractive because controlling cultivation, processing, and quality management can provide greater oversight across the supply chain.
Strategic partnerships between growers, ingredient processors, cosmetic formulators, beverage companies, and research organizations may also support innovation.
Investment in research and development will remain important. Companies that can develop stable, high-purity, application-specific aloe vera ingredients may have stronger opportunities than suppliers competing primarily on volume and price.
